FWIW, I had to do something similar on my AMC 304...seems the bypass circuit is WAY generous and causes some overheating issues... found a nice AL slug (fit snug in the hose, but was too big to be ingested by the pump), drilled a 1/4" hole in it, and slapped it in... running temps decreased by 15*F right off the bat!
